.elementor-564 .elementor-element.elementor-element-6d2920fc{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--justify-content:flex-start;--gap:0px 0px;--row-gap:0px;--column-gap:0px;--padding-top:10px;--padding-bottom:10px;--padding-left:20px;--padding-right:20px;}.elementor-564 .elementor-element.elementor-element-36ce1e57{--e-image-carousel-slides-to-show:6;margin:0px 0px calc(var(--kit-widget-spacing, 0px) + 0px) 0px;}.elementor-564 .elementor-element.elementor-element-36ce1e57 .swiper-wrapper{display:flex;align-items:center;}@media(max-width:1024px){.elementor-564 .elementor-element.elementor-element-36ce1e57{--e-image-carousel-slides-to-show:4;}}@media(max-width:767px){.elementor-564 .elementor-element.elementor-element-36ce1e57{--e-image-carousel-slides-to-show:3;}}/* Start custom CSS for image-carousel, class: .elementor-element-36ce1e57 */#my-carousel-k1369 .swiper-wrapper {
  -webkit-transition-timing-function: linear !important;
  -moz-transition-timing-function: linear !important;
  -o-transition-timing-function: linear !important;
  transition-timing-function: linear !important;
}
#my-carousel-k1369 {
  position: relative;
  overflow: hidden;
  background-color: transparent;
}
#my-carousel-k1369::before,
#my-carousel-k1369::after {
  content: "";
  position: absolute;
  top: 0;
  width: 15vw;
  height: 100%;
  z-index: 2;
  pointer-events: none;
}
#my-carousel-k1369::before {
  left: 0;
  background: linear-gradient(to right, transparent 20%, rgba(0,0,0,0));
}
#my-carousel-k1369::after {
  right: 0;
  background: linear-gradient(to left, transparent 20%, rgba(0,0,0,0));
}/* End custom CSS */